Most connector leaks come from a loose fit, a missing washer, or debris inside the fitting.
Expandable hoses commonly leak when the rubber washer inside the connector is missing, damaged, or not seated properly.
Pocket Hose sprayers include three extra rubber washers, and only one should be inside the fitting at a time. Over-tightening can warp connectors, while cross-threading prevents a secure seal. Check for debris or mineral buildup inside the connector, as this can also cause leaks.
Key Takeaways:
-
Ensure exactly one rubber washer is installed
-
Avoid cross-threading or over-tightening
-
Remove debris from connectors
-
Replace worn washers for a quick repair
